Last updated 3 years ago
NFTs are very illiquid; to exchange virtual items quickly, such as trading cards, you'll likely lose money and time in the process.
NFT-FT pools create a market for instant NFT liquidity so you can easily and efficiently swap one gaming asset for another.
This is the total amount allocated to NFT pools for game asset swaps.
NFT-FT pools create a market for instant NFT liquidity so you can easily and efficiently swap one gaming asset for another.
We're two first cohort Plutus Pioneers and Haskell developers with a passion for NFTs and gaming
NFT = non-fungible token, FT = fungible token
Overview
Fungify is a Plutus-native NFT-FT pooling protocol, a key component required to expand NFT capabilities. NFT-FT pools enable people to do the following:
NFT-FT pools allow efficient and fast NFT swaps, so you can easily convert your gaming assets to whatever you need in the current moment. This means you don't have to make deals and trades, often losing value when looking for a quick swap. This could prove especially useful for simple NFT trading card games, some of the more feasible early-stage games that have already started, and will continue to pop up in the next few months. Gamers can also earn yield on their inventory by providing liquidity to these pools.
Play-to-earn games on other platforms have begun engineering advanced and intricate economies, enough so to prompt Axie Infinity to make their own internal DEX for in-game assets. Fungify's NFT-FT pools provide a generalized solution for Cardano game creators to use when exploring this frontier. Given how prevalent NFTs are in gaming, we believe there is great opportunity for creative applications of these pools.
How do NFT-FT pools work?
A NFT-FT pool works by locking a NFT into a pool, specific to that NFT's project, in exchange for fungible pTokens. pTokens represent a claim to one of the NFTs in the pool, and can be redeemed for a NFT contained in the same pool.
pTokens can be traded on any open market, such as SundaeSwap, where the price will be discovered through arbitrageurs. The price reflects the "floor" of the project. NFT holders can convert their NFTs to pTokens through the pool and sell them at this price for immediate liquidity. The liquid market allows NFTs to be used as collateral for loans. Liquidity providers for market making pairs can earn yield on their pTokens. People can buy fractions of NFTs represented by pTokens to track a project like an index fund. Assets of the same type can be easily swapped for another, a common use case in the metaverse, where certain quests require certain items.
Fungify V1
Fungify V1, with core functionality for swapping NFTs/FTs from a pool and a farming script for LPs to earn yield, is currently going through intensive internal testing and final touches are being made. We plan to release Fungify V1 this January. Liquid markets will be set up for several projects in order to showcase Fungify's potential.
To follow our progress on V1, hop into our Discord: https://discord.com/invite/4f36hKZBBd
To learn more, check out our docs: https://sicks0sicks.gitbook.io/fungify/
Roadmap
This proposal is for building upon the Fungify V1 foundation to improve pool customizability and UTXO parallelization. These will be important in accommodating a large audience and a wide range of gaming use cases. This proposal covers the next 0-3 months of the roadmap. Further funding for the implementation of UTXO parallelization will be applied for in fund8.
In the next 0-3 Months
In the next 3-6 Months
In the next 6-12 Months
Auditability
Fungify major releases V1 and V2 will go through an official code audit. Progress can be tracked through the number of projects using customized Fungify NFT-FT pools. Success can be measured through the number of games built utilizing and the number of game assets swapped using Fungify NFT-FT pool infrastructure. Success after 6 months will look like 5+ games using Fungify NFT-FT pools.
Risks/Open Questions
How would this help Cardano become the go to blockchain to develop gaming applications?
Fungify lays down the base infrastructure for the Cardano gaming ecosystem to be built upon. NFT-FT pools enable games with more complex NFT based mechanisms and for players to earn yield on their gaming assets. This proposal would ensure this tooling is available to all game creators and is optimized for the high frequency swapping expected from gaming application use-cases.
Funding breakdown
2 Haskell/Plutus devs for 150 hours at $50/hr = $15000
Total $15000
We're two first cohort Plutus Pioneers and Haskell developers with a passion for NFTs and gaming